RICO is a federal law that that was enacted to allow enhanced prosecution of racketeering crimes. It’s a statute under which specific crimes are charged . She’s correct and schooled Cancun Cruz: The moment from the hearing attracted the attention of Cruz, a Texas Republican, who said on X (formerly Twitter) early Thursday morning that Ocasio-Cortez's comments were "bizarre." "RICO—the Racketeer Influenced & Corrupt Organizations Act, 18 U.S.C. §§ 1961–1968—is most assuredly a crime," Cruz wrote. "It often results in massive felony sentences. And yet @aoc—eager to defend Joe Biden—insists it's not a crime." Ocasio-Cortez responded to Cruz's post later on Thursday, writing: "Wrong! RICO is a statute under which specific crimes may be considered - kidnapping, robbery, arson, etc." https://www.msn.com/en-us/news/other/aoc-challenges-ted-cruz-on-rico-meaning/ar-BB1kjeUk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
